codeql-analysis.yml 694 B

1234567891011121314151617181920212223242526272829303132
  1. name: "CodeQL"
  2. on:
  3. push:
  4. branches: [ "master" ]
  5. pull_request:
  6. branches: [ "master" ]
  7. jobs:
  8. analyze:
  9. # lgtm.com does not run in forks, for good reason
  10. if: github.repository == 'mesonbuild/meson'
  11. name: Analyze
  12. runs-on: ubuntu-latest
  13. permissions:
  14. security-events: write
  15. steps:
  16. - name: Checkout repository
  17. uses: actions/checkout@v3
  18. - name: Initialize CodeQL
  19. uses: github/codeql-action/init@v2
  20. with:
  21. config-file: .github/codeql/codeql-config.yml
  22. languages: python
  23. # we have none
  24. setup-python-dependencies: false
  25. - name: Perform CodeQL Analysis
  26. uses: github/codeql-action/analyze@v2